Limits

The limits of your homeowners insurance policy determine the maximum amount that your insurance company will pay for each covered peril. For example, if you have a policy with a $100,000 limit for dwelling coverage, your insurance company will pay up to $100,000 to repair or rebuild your home if it is damaged by a covered peril, such as a fire or windstorm.

  • Dwelling coverage: This covers the structure of your home, including the walls, roof, and foundation.
  • Other structures coverage: This covers structures on your property that are not attached to your home, such as a detached garage or shed.
  • Personal property coverage: This covers your belongings, such as furniture, clothing, and electronics.
  • Loss of use coverage: This covers additional living expenses if you are unable to live in your home due to a covered peril.

It is important to choose the right limits for your homeowners insurance policy. If you choose limits that are too low, you may not have enough coverage to repair or replace your home and belongings in the event of a covered peril. However, if you choose limits that are too high, you will pay more for your insurance premiums.

When choosing limits for your homeowners insurance policy, you should consider the value of your home and belongings, as well as your financial situation. You should also talk to your insurance agent to get help choosing the right limits for your needs.

Deductible

The deductible is an important part of house insurance Utah. It is the amount of money that you will have to pay out of pocket before your insurance coverage kicks in. Deductibles can vary depending on the insurance company and the type of coverage you choose.

  • Lower deductibles: Lower deductibles mean that you will pay less out of pocket if you need to file a claim. However, lower deductibles also mean that you will pay higher premiums.
  • Higher deductibles: Higher deductibles mean that you will pay more out of pocket if you need to file a claim. However, higher deductibles also mean that you will pay lower premiums.

When choosing a deductible, it is important to consider your financial situation and your risk tolerance. If you are comfortable paying a higher deductible, you can save money on your premiums. However, if you are not comfortable paying a higher deductible, you may want to choose a lower deductible, even if it means paying higher premiums.

Claims

Filing a claim with your house insurance Utah provider can be a stressful and time-consuming process, but it is important to understand your rights and responsibilities as a policyholder. By following these tips, you can help to ensure that your claim is processed quickly and efficiently.

  • Report the claim promptly. The sooner you report the claim, the sooner the insurance company can begin investigating and processing it. Most policies require you to report the claim within a certain period of time, so it is important to act quickly.
  • Be prepared to provide documentation. The insurance company will need to see documentation of the damage or loss, such as photographs, receipts, and estimates from contractors. Having this documentation ready will help to speed up the claims process.
  • Keep a record of all communication. Keep a record of all communication with the insurance company, including phone calls, emails, and letters. This will help you to track the progress of your claim and ensure that you are getting the coverage you deserve.
  • Be patient. The claims process can take time, especially if the damage is extensive. Be patient and work with the insurance company to get your claim resolved.

By following these tips, you can help to ensure that your house insurance Utah claim is processed quickly and efficiently. Filing a claim can be a stressful experience, but by being prepared and organized, you can make the process as smooth as possible.
